How to take a task

First, it should be noted that the task in Dragon Age Origins “Dead Castle” often passes by players, because it can only be taken from a hidden location in the Deep Roads. This area is called Dead Moats and is notable for the fact that it does not open immediately. Entrance to it becomes available to the player only after Branka’s diary is found in the Ortan taiga. This item can be considered key for the task, because without it it will not be possible to even try to complete the mission. The reward for completion will be full armor of the Legion of the Dead with, which gives good protection. It can be put on the main character or given to one of his comrades.

Like any self-respecting modern RPG, Dragon Age: Inquisition also includes crafting armor and weapons. Unlike the first part, here crafting is not limited to inserting runes - now we are given the opportunity to create a thing from scratch, choosing the appearance, type, material, which gives the necessary bonuses and improvements. Although the runes also remain, where would we be without them? Sketches of weapons and armor

At the very beginning, to create items, upgrades or runes, you will need sketches of these same items, upgrades and runes. Where can I get them? In chests, from merchants, missions at headquarters, sometimes even from bosses. Sketches are displayed in the list of items available for crafting; they can be used as much as you like and, best of all, they do not take up space in your inventory.

There are only 3 levels of sketches in the game. The higher it is, the more cells there will be in the item, the better quality and with more bonuses it will be possible to create the item. Level 1 sketches require the presence of 2 cells, level 2 - 3 cells, level 3 sketches - 4 cells.

The crafting system here is logical - heavy armor will require a large amount of metal, a little less leather and rarely will you need fabric, but for a mage's robe it's the opposite. For swords and weapon hilts, you need a base, as well as a leather or fabric braid and the like.

There are 4 types of cells in total: the main one, which determines the basic parameters, and three additional ones, the set of which may vary depending on the sketch. Namely:

Damage— the main cell for weapons, determines damage per second depending on the material, as well as the type of elemental attack of the staff.

Attack— an additional slot for weapons and weapon upgrades. Depending on the material, it adds bonuses to attack types or the likelihood of imposing status effects on the enemy.

Armor— the main cell for armor, determines the level of armor depending on the material and protection from physical damage in melee.

Protection- additional slot for armor and armor upgrades. Depending on the material, it adds resistance bonuses from elemental, ranged and magical attacks, as well as the likelihood of retaliatory bleeding or additional health.

Support— an additional cell for all types of items. Depending on the material, it adds stat points (dexterity, magic, etc.).

For upgrades of any level, only two additional slots are always available; upgrades can only add bonuses and/or stat points, but not damage or armor level (the exception is Bianca).

Types of improvements and crafting

Armor

There are 3 types of armor available for crafting (light, medium and heavy), as well as helmets of each of the three types. For almost all types of armor, two upgrade slots are available: bracers and leggings (the exception is special armor like the Elven Guardian Robe or the armor of the Legion of the Dead). Improvements are created separately, but according to a similar principle.

Sometimes ready-made improvements can be found in chests or received as a reward for completing a mission at headquarters. Improvements can also be removed from dropped items and placed on others.

Separately, it is worth mentioning Bianca, since the weapon is unique. You can increase damage control and characteristics only with the help of improvements. Bianca has 3 upgrade slots available - Shoulders, Sight, Handle. The main cell is available for the shoulders, which increases damage control, there is also one support cell for the handle, and one attack cell is available for the sight. Crafting materials

To create weapons and armor in the game there are 3 types of materials: metal, leather and fabric, in turn they are further divided into 3 levels. The higher the level of the material, the higher the level of armor or bonus indicator. The type of armor also varies depending on the material.

Metal

Metal is found using the search button (or a keen eye) in caves and on mountain slopes in the form of small clusters of several types of each per location. In the Emerald Graves in the Argon Shack you can buy Perfect Chandelier, obsidian and pyrophyte, and Sero Colored Glass is sold in Skyhold from a merchant from Orlais.

Excellent things

You will have the opportunity to create excellent things in Skyhold after inviting the enchantress (mission at headquarters). When creating an item, a separate slot for an excellent item appears, right above the main one. Ordinary materials will not work here. For an excellent item, you need metals, leathers or fabrics touched by the Shadow that come across randomly during collection, as well as special finds like a dragon tooth or iron bark. Only one unit of such material can be inserted into a cell, but filling it is not required.

Special materials provide a short-term ability, such as Walking Fortress, Unbreakable or Shadow Cloak, a chance to gain a bonus to focus accumulation or heal up to 15% of health on a killing blow. Possible bonuses are generated randomly, and there are many of them.

Ostagar and the Wild Lands

Sick dog

Dwarven politics

Talk to the huntsman in the camp and he will tell you about a sick mabari who swallowed tainted blood. To cure him, you need a special flower that grows in the wild lands of Korcari. According to the plot, you will still have to visit there, so feel free to agree. Look in the ruins a couple of meters from the place where you will meet a wounded soldier. The cured dog will join you after the Battle of Ostagar, if you have not yet acquired a pet.

Hungry Prisoner

In the camp, an unfortunate soldier is hanging in a cage. Not only are they not letting him out, but they are also not feeding him. The poor guy will ask you to get him some food. Before giving consent and food, ask the prisoner why he was imprisoned. At the end of the story, you can demand the key to the magicians' chest from the prisoner. You can get food from the guard by convincing or bribing him. And the chest can be opened only after returning from the wild lands, when the pacified one leaves him.

Sword

You can trick the messenger Peak into getting a good sword. But first the boy must be caught - find him with the warriors of the ash, and then run after him.

Missionary Chest

Near the border of the wild lands you will find the body of the missionary Jogby. You can remove a letter from it with hints on where to find the treasure. Look for the chest in the south of the map.

Traces of chasing

In the west of the wild lands there is an abandoned parking lot and a chest containing a magazine. Read it and follow the mark that appears. A chain of such traces will lead you to the treasure.

Orzammar

Lost Son

The story is over. The hero stands on the road and thoughtfully looks at the sunset... But it’s too early for him to retire!

In the Common Halls we will come across Filda. Her son went to the deep paths and did not return. We will find the hand in the Ortan tag, it is connected with the plot - don’t miss it.

Church

Berkel wants to open a church in Orzammar. You can help him with this by convincing the chronicler (in the hall of guardians) to give permission. The reward you will receive is meager, but this church will have a decisive influence on the fate of the world. And not the most favorable...

Dwarven magician

Dagna really wants to get into the circle of magicians. You can stop her by telling her father Jannar about his daughter’s plans, or you can help by talking to the first sorcerer, if, of course, he is alive. As a reward we will receive a good rune or lyrium. In addition, Dagna will become an outstanding scientist.

Search for Nagas

All his pets fled from the beater Bemor. You need to look for Nagas in the Community Halls, there are five of them in total. For each animal we get 25 silver coins. And if you talk to Leliana after this, she will admit that she really wants such an animal. You can get it in Dusty Town from an idle gnome for a modest fee. Now this “hedgehog” will live with you in the camp.

Racket

After receiving the first task from any of the contenders for the throne and leaving the Diamond Halls, you will see local bandits threatening the merchant Figor. If you follow them to the shop, you can help the merchant. If you settle the matter peacefully, he will thank you and stay to trade, but if you kill the robbers, then... he will scold you and run away.

Fights without rules

In the west of the Test Halls, in a small room there is a gunsmith who will offer to take part in the battles. The reward for each battle is trivial, but the ring that you receive after four victories is good for blood mages.

Unwanted child

In the Dusty City you can find an unfortunate dwarf who was kicked out of her family because she gave birth to a son from an untouchable. You can force her to get rid of her son, as her relatives want, or you can convince the latter that they are wrong and restore the family.

Overlander's Sword

In the deep paths you can get hold of one of the best one-handed swords - By the honor of the overlander. First, find a tomb in the Ortan taiga (southeast corner). Now we are looking for pieces:

    The pommel lies in the Ortan teig in a vase in the Ruka cave.

    The hilt can be removed from the corpse of the Genlock Emissary at the Caridina Crossroads (Genlock is waiting for you in the tunnel that runs from west to south).

    The blade is removed from the corpse of an ancient creature of darkness in the Dead Moats (on the bridge in the center of the map).

Once you find everything, return to the tomb.
